Yeoman Wayne Dowson

Also known as "Wayne"

21 November 19458 February 2023

Passed away peacefully at Warkworth Hospital on Wednesday 8 February 2023, aged 77 years.

Much loved husband of Rowena.

Loved father and father-in-law of Sharon and Jim, Lisa, Vicky and Paul, Kim and Duncan, and Lance and Kathy. 

Loved Grandad of Shelby, Melanie, Lachlan, Charleigh, Isabel, Spencer and Jasper.

A service was held at St. Michaels and All Angels Church, Hakaru on Thursday 16 February at 1:00pm, followed by burial in the Hakaru Cemetery.
